What is recorded here

Formally-planned terraced gardens, designed 1930, completed c.1940. Comprising planted areas with geometrically arranged paths in fan-shaped area, with numerous stone monuments. Carved granite cruciform memorial with inscribed dates to south, set on circular-plan stepped plinth. Flights of steps to south. Central inscribed rectangular-plan carved granite block on granite plinth, flanked by circular fountains comprising carved boundary wall, raised central platform and obelisk. Two pairs of square-plan book rooms, to east and west of fountains, each pair connected by carved granite Doric colonnade forming pergola. Each book room having corbelled pyramidal granite roof, cut granite walls, granite plinth course. Doric porticos to each elevation, having broken base pediment. Niches with dropped keystones and impost course to east and west elevations. Oval oculi to north and south elevations, carved granite surrounds and keystones. Square-headed door openings to interior elevations, carved granite architrave surrounds, timber panelled doors. Snecked splayed limestone walls flanking book rooms, gateways flanked by square-profile granite piers having engaged columns, caps with ball finials, matching piers interrupting walls, walls terminating in pedimented cut granite screen, round-headed niche flanked by Doric portico, columns flanking sides, ball finials to top. Circular-profile sunken stepped garden to exterior of pergolas, granite steps, planters surrounded by hedging, centring on circular fountain. Circular-profile carved granite gazebo to north, granite Doric columns and entablature, copper cupola, granite steps, inscription to floor to interior. Books of names of war dead to interior of book rooms, timber cross to interior.
